Embedding and Extracting Hidden Messages in Images Using LSB-Based Steganography

This paper explores the implementation of image-based steganography utilizing the Least Significant Bit (LSB) method to embed and extract hidden messages within digital images. The approach leverages the imperceptibility of minor pixel alterations to conceal information, ensuring the visual integrity of the cover image. The study provides a detailed explanation of the LSB technique, its implementation, and potential applications in secure communication.
